Book class diagram for atm system projects

Instead of using atm card fingerprint based atm is safer and secure. Atm processyou can edit this template and create your own diagram. There are two toplevel classes atmmain and atmapplet which allow the system to be run respectively as an application or as an applet. A free customizable atm system data flow template is provided to download and print. Atm fr6 a transaction record can be printed upon demand. Aug 02, 2017 car rental system class diagram describes the structure of a car rental system classes, their attributes, operations or methods, and the relationships among objects. Uber class diagram class diagram for uber system to visualize the different classes and relationships of the uber system.

Library management system class diagram describes the structured class diagram of library management system, their attributes, methods and relationships among objects. This document contain all the uml diagrams for bank atm system. I consider it crucial to make sure my readers know. Class diagrams describe the static structure of a system, or how it is structured rather than how it behaves.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ately viewer. This example of uml class diagram models bank account system. As we discussed in the previous sections, the mvc pattern has the following main participants. Classes, which represent entities with common characteristics or features.

On this page we will present some uml diagram examples for proper understanding of this technique. This template will help you get ideas for your own uml activity diagram design. Library management system class diagram freeprojectz. To draw a class diagram representing various aspects of an application, few of the properties which needs to be considered are a meaningful name should be given to a class diagram describing a systems real aspect. Creately diagrams can be exported and added to word, ppt powerpoint, excel, visio or any other document. This subject is called as uml in mumbai university mca colleges. If you continue browsing the site, you agree to the use of cookies on this website. Examples of uml diagrams use case, class, component. Click on the diagram to edit online and download as image files.

An atm allows patrons to access their bank accounts through a completely automated process. Proposed design of an inventory database system at process research ortech system design prepared by. Level 1 data flow diagram for a ticket reservation system. A class diagram describes the types of objects in the system and the different types of relationships that exist among them. Feb 07, 2018 learn how to make use case diagrams in this tutorial. To see image properly click on the image class diagram for book store collaboration diagram for book store seq. Completed sequence diagram activity diagram state diagram ta initials. Level 1 data flow diagram for a ticket reservation. In software engineering, a class diagram in the unified modeling language uml is a type of static structure diagram that describes the structure of a system by showing the systems classes, their attributes, operations or methods, and the relationships among objects. Aug 02, 2017 library management system class diagram describes the structure of a library management system classes, their attributes, operations or methods, and the relationships among objects. Withdraw, deposit, pay bill, account update and exit. Once the user had registered himself he has to login in order to book the ticket. Atm editable uml activity diagram template on creately.

How indeed does one go about it, without seeing an example of uml diagrams. You just have to use your fingerprint in order to do any banking transaction. A class diagram in the unified modeling language uml is a type of static structure diagram that describes the structure of a system by showing the system s. Classes, operations and the relationship between objects in the system, is shown in this diagram. Uml diagrams examples examples by technology or application domain. Learn how to make use case diagrams in this tutorial. Abstract 4 atm system the atm system is the project which is used to access their bank accounts in. Security features of atm, security of atm machine, atm security ppt, atm. Here is a bank uml activity diagram shared by our customer. How to draw class diagram by kaustubh joshi youtube.

The draganddrop interface is responsive and easy to learn. In software engineering, a class diagram in the unified modeling language uml is a type of static structure diagram that describes the structure of a system by showing the system s classes, their attributes, operations or methods, and the relationships among objects. Quickly get a headstart when creating your own data flow.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. You can edit this template and create your own diagram. Entity relationship diagram recommended information literacy. Class uml diagram for bank account system bank uml. Describe use cases that an automated teller machine atm or the automatic banking machine abm provides to the bank customers summary. Use pdf export for high quality prints and svg export for large sharp images or.

Apr 24, 2017 atm fr4 a menu is displayed to the user with following options. System analysis and design ii ism 326 atm project student name. Banking management system uml diagram freeprojectz. This diagram is interesting both for what it shows, and for what it does not show. The uml class diagram is a graphical notation used to construct and visualize object oriented systems. In this chapter, we take a deeper look at the details of programming with classes. The finger print minutiae features are different for each human being so the user can be identified uniquely. Note that i have taken pains to mark all the interfaces. Atmfr4 a menu is displayed to the user with following options. The uml class diagram is a static diagram describes system structure combines a number of model elements. Click on the image to use as a template or download. Atm fr7 the card is ejected when the session is completed.

Then you will get a chance to try to attack another teams design. Library management system class diagram describes the structure of a library management system classes, their attributes, operations or methods, and the relationships among objects. Generally, a class diagram highlights the object orientation of a system is the most widely used diagram when it comes to system construction. The main classes of the library management system are student, books, issues, librarian, member, address. Uml diagrams library management system programs and notes. Bank uml activity diagram free bank uml activity diagram. May 19, 20 uml diagrams for atm machine class diagram for atm machine use case diagram for atm machine state diagram for atm system. You can examine the steps of this process in a manageable way by drawing or viewing a sequence diagram. A class diagram in the unified modeling language uml is a type of static structure diagram that describes the structure of a system by showing the systems. A use case is an event or action with reference to the useractor of the eventactions that should be performed through the software. These types of diagrams represent the objectoriented view of a system that is largely static in nature. Oct 1, 2019 class diagrams are what most diagrammers are used to, since they are the most common type when it comes to uml design. Try this easy method to make outstanding uml diagrams.

I have tried to make these instructions as explicit as possible. Creating a class diagram is a straightforward process. Class diagram for bank atm system editable uml class. A uml class diagram for the mvc design pattern lets now understand more about the mvc pattern with the help of the following uml diagram. The diagrams show an example of objects interaction in time sequence in a booking system. Car rental system class diagram describes the structure of a car rental system classes, their attributes, operations or methods, and the relationships among objects. A uml class diagram for the mvc design pattern learning. Package diagram for example atm system gordon college. Aug 11, 2017 in this video, kaustubh joshi talks about how to draw a class diagram using a tennis court booking application as an example.

For software development, the most important uml diagram is the class diagram. Use case diagrams and examples in software engineering. It depicts the objects and classes involved in the scenario and the sequence of messages exchanged between the objects needed to carry out the functionality of the scenario. Lets see the use case diagrams and examples in software engineering.

This site provides free download management system project report. Bank atm uml diagrams examples use cases, state diagram. The example below outlines the sequential order of the interactions in the atm system. Uml diagrams library management system programs and. Figure 38 shows a simple class diagram of part of an atm system. A bank account can be a deposit account, a credit card, or any other type of account offered by a financial institution. The financial transactions which have occurred within a given period of time on a bank account are reported to the. A bank account is a financial account between a bank customer and a financial institution. Lucidchart comes populated with an extensive shape library for every uml diagram type, including activity diagrams, class diagrams, and use case diagrams. Both beginners and intermediate uml diagrammers will find all the necessary training and examples on. Class diagram examples communication diagram examples component diagram examples.

This page is the starting point into a series of pages that attempt to give a complete example of objectoriented analysis, design, and programming applied to a small size problem. Click the image to edit online and download as an image file. In our atm system, the above problem is overcome here, the transactions are done in person by the customer thus makes the customers feel safe and secure. This use case diagram is a visual representation of the prose scenario shown above. A visual appealing data flow diagram like this could be done in less than ten minutes. The below diagrams are has come up in mumbai university mca exams.

To do this, simply use a class diagram in which each actor is linked to a central class representing the system by an association, which enables the number of instances of actors connected to the system at a given time to be specified. Describe use cases that an automated teller machine atm or the automatic banking machine abm provides to the bank customers. System use case diagrams ticket vending machine bank atm uml use case diagrams examples point of sales pos terminal. Super admin, system user, accountant, customers, who perform the different type of use cases such as manage customer, manage employees, manage accounts, manage fixed deposit, manage saving account, manage current account, manage balance, manage users and full banking management system operations. This modeling method can run with almost all objectoriented methods. Create the uml use case diagram for a system to buy dvds online. These pages are similar in style to another, more complicated set of pages i developed earlier. Customer uses a bank atm to check balances of hisher bank accounts, deposit funds, withdraw cash andor transfer funds use cases. There is no worry of losing atm card and no need to carry atm card in your wallet. Bsc it cs project documentation information technology students, mca projects, bca projects, msc computer science projects, b tech bachelor of technology in cs. Class diagram for bank atm system class diagram uml use createlys easy online diagram editor to edit this diagram, collaborate with others and export results to multiple image formats. Uml diagrams for atm machine programs and notes for mca. To efficiently create the uml diagram, it is better to start from the editable uml diagram examples. Uml diagrams library management system unified modelling language practicals.

Atmfr6 a transaction record can be printed upon demand. Creately is an easy to use diagram and flowchart software built for team collaboration. May 04, 2015 this document contain all the uml diagrams for bank atm system. Problem statement the project entitled atm system has a drastic change to that of the older version of banking system, customer feel inconvenient with the transaction method as it was in the hands of the bank employees. Then it is time to study the flows of events in detail. Classes of library management system class diagram. Class uml diagram for bank account system bank uml diagram. Proposed design of an inventory database system at process. Atm system data flow free atm system data flow templates. Banking atm is a open source you can download zip and edit as per you need. In this video, kaustubh joshi talks about how to draw a class diagram using a tennis court booking application as an example. Proposed design of an inventory database system at. Atmfr5 the cash dispenser has the ability to dispense cash. The analysis class diagram captures the basic class structure implied by the use case flows of events.

I have also recently found a great activity diagram for atm system uml through lucidchart that is very helpful. The main actors of banking management system in this use case diagram are. Activity diagram for atm system editable uml activity. Atm fr5 the cash dispenser has the ability to dispense cash. Atm or rather automated teller machine is also called as any time money by many. This is simple and basic level small project for learning purpose. Atm technician provides maintenance and repairs to the atm. The atm is given the utmost security in terms of technology because its a stand alone system and easily prone to malicious attacks. Class diagram proscons class diagrams are great for. Before studying the flows of events in detail, it might be helpful to look at the diagram showing the analysis classes to get an overall view of the system implicit in the use cases. Atm system 1 problem statement the project entitled atm. Online flight reservation system is a web application that helps the commuters to book flight ticket online.

In order to book ticket, the commuter has to register himself by filling up the details. Atms system is very simple as customers need to press some buttons to receive cash. The package diagram shows how the various classes are grouped into packages. The overall list of your systems use cases can be drawn as highdrawn as highlevel diagrams with.